docker-compose container name separator switches between - and _. · Issue #24 · docker/compose-switch (original) (raw)

Skip to content

Provide feedback

Saved searches

Use saved searches to filter your results more quickly

Sign up

@m000

Description

@m000

Actual behavior

docker-compose switches between - and _ as a container name separator between releases.

Expected behavior

docker-compose must consistently use - as a container name separator.

Information

Steps to reproduce the behavior

volumes:
postgres:

creates separator-test_db_1

docker-compose -f docker-compose-test.yaml -p separator-test down
sudo wget -q https://github.com/docker/compose/releases/download/v2.2.1/docker-compose-linux-x86_64 -O /usr/local/bin/docker-compose-v2.2.1-gh
sudo ln -sf /usr/local/bin/docker-compose-v2.2.1-gh /usr/bin/docker-compose
docker-compose -f docker-compose-test.yaml -p separator-test up

creates separator-test-db-1

docker-compose -f docker-compose-test.yaml -p separator-test down
sudo ln -sf /mnt/wsl/docker-desktop/cli-tools/usr/bin/docker-compose /usr/bin/docker-compose /usr/bin/docker-compose